Postdoctoral Positions in Gastroenterology and Immunology
Postdoctoral training positions are available in the laboratory of Hans-Christian Reinecker MD, in the Department of Internal Medicine, the Division of Digestive and Liver Diseases at UT Southwestern Medical Center. The focus of the research program is on mechanism of inflammatory bowel diseases, anti-microbial host defenses and intestinal tumorigenesis. Projects unravel new pathways of innate immune recognition for viral and bacterial pathogens and control of mucosal immunity.
Candidates must hold a Ph.D. and/or M.D. degree. Experience in Immunology, Oncology or Microbiology in addition to a solid foundation in molecular and cell biology is required. Prior experiences in protein mutagenesis, gene targeting approaches or biochemistry is preferred. Prior work leading to publication in peer-reviewed journals is recommended.
